Alyssa S. Haynes is a scholar working on Materials Chemistry, Electronic, Optical and Magnetic Materials and Electrical and Electronic Engineering. According to data from OpenAlex, Alyssa S. Haynes has authored 10 papers receiving a total of 513 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 8 papers in Materials Chemistry, 7 papers in Electronic, Optical and Magnetic Materials and 3 papers in Electrical and Electronic Engineering. Recurrent topics in Alyssa S. Haynes’s work include Crystal Structures and Properties (7 papers), Solid-state spectroscopy and crystallography (5 papers) and Nonlinear Optical Materials Research (4 papers). Alyssa S. Haynes is often cited by papers focused on Crystal Structures and Properties (7 papers), Solid-state spectroscopy and crystallography (5 papers) and Nonlinear Optical Materials Research (4 papers). Alyssa S. Haynes collaborates with scholars based in United States, Taiwan and Germany. Alyssa S. Haynes's co-authors include Robert J. Hickey, So‐Jung Park, James M. Kikkawa, Mercouri G. Kanatzidis, Joon I. Jang, Felix O. Saouma, Daniel J. Clark, Daniel P. Shoemaker, Constantinos C. Stoumpos and Daniel G. Chica and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of the American Chemical Society, Chemistry of Materials and Journal of Solid State Chemistry.
